Along solicits suggestions for Sankalp Patra

KOHIMA — Minister of Tourism and Higher Education, Temjen Imna Along, on Friday appealed to the people across the state to give their suggestions for the nation, state and the people through the Sankalp Patra Box or give a missed call or voice message to 909090-2024.

He stated this at the launch event of Sankalp Patra at the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) Nagaland state headquarters in Kohima.

Explaining that ‘Sankalp’ means vision and ‘Patra’ means document, he said the BJP as the world’s largest political party under the leadership of the national president JP Nadda has taken a lead to take the view of the people for the party manifesto, which he claimed is a first of its kind.

Along said the initiative was to take views and suggestions from every nook and corner of the country to be included in the party manifesto and added that the Sankapl Patra van will be touring in various districts and organise events. He stated that the move was to make India developed by 2047 under the leadership of Prime Minister, Narendra Modi.

The former president of BJP Nagaland and minister claimed that about 98% of the BJP manifesto and its commitment in 2014 and 2019 under the leadership of Prime Minister, Narendra Modi, were fulfilled.

He informed that for the BJP, manifesto is like a holy book to build the people of the nation.

Advisor of Printing and Stationeries and Prison, Kropol Vitsu, commended the initiative of the journey of India towards Viksit Bharat and hailed the leadership of Prime Minister, Narendra Modi, and the party led by its president JP Nadda.

He called for active participation of the people in the state saying that to make India a developed nation, it needs collective decision and ideas.

Vitsu also explained how India has changed the narratives from Look East Policy to Act East Policy and asserted the need for the development of Nagaland at par with the rest of the nation to make India a developed nation by 2047.
